Patient Consent
Obtaining Informed Consent from patients is a fundamental ethical requirement in Genetic Testing protocols. Patients must be fully informed about the purpose of the test, the potential risks and benefits, and how their genetic information will be used. Without Informed Consent, patients may not fully understand the implications of Genetic Testing, leading to potential harm or misuse of their genetic data.
Key considerations for Patient Consent in Genetic Testing include:
- Ensuring patients have access to clear and understandable information about the test.
- Allowing patients to ask questions and seek clarification before agreeing to undergo Genetic Testing.
- Respecting patients' right to refuse testing or to withdraw consent at any time during the process.
Confidentiality
Protecting Patient Confidentiality is another critical ethical consideration in Genetic Testing protocols. Genetic information is highly sensitive and can have far-reaching implications for an individual's health, privacy, and even employment opportunities. Medical laboratories and phlebotomy professionals must take measures to safeguard patient data and ensure that it is not improperly disclosed or used without consent.
Strategies for maintaining Patient Confidentiality in Genetic Testing include:
- Implementing secure data storage and transmission protocols to prevent unauthorized access to genetic information.
- Requiring Healthcare Providers and laboratory staff to undergo training on Patient Confidentiality and data security best practices.
- Obtaining Patient Consent before sharing genetic information with third parties, such as insurance companies or researchers.
Impact on Genetic Testing Protocols
Failure to address ethical concerns regarding Patient Consent and confidentiality can have significant implications for Genetic Testing protocols in the United States. Without clear guidelines and robust privacy protections, patients may be reluctant to undergo Genetic Testing, leading to missed opportunities for early detection and personalized treatment of genetic disorders.
Furthermore, breaches of Patient Confidentiality can erode trust between Healthcare Providers and patients, undermining the credibility of Genetic Testing services and potentially resulting in legal repercussions for healthcare organizations.
